#08149e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08149e is composed of 3.1% red, 7.8%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 87.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 235.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 32.5%. #08149e color hex could be obtained by blending #1028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#08149e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08149e has RGB values of R:8, G:20,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 529566.

Shades and Tints of #08149e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000109 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#08149e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4f58 is the less saturated color, while #020fa4 is the most saturated one.
